What Is Copper Lipstick?

Copper lipstick is a special type of lip color. It looks shiny, warm, and reddish-brown like the metal copper. Imagine the bright orange-brown color of a new penny. Using copper lipstick will help your lips shine!

  • Color: A warm mix of red, brown, and orange
  • Finish: Often metallic and shiny, or smooth with a soft glow

People love copper lipstick because it gives a bold and attractive look. It is perfect for evenings and special events.

Is It Safe to Use Copper Lipstick?

The U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A) checks lipsticks for harmful metals like lead.

Studies show most lipsticks have very low lead content—less than 10 parts per million (ppm). According to FDA guidelines, lipsticks should not contain more than 10 ppm of lead.

Most lipsticks fall between undetectable levels and 7 ppm, well below the safety limit.

So yes, copper lipsticks properly made and sold by trusted brands are safe to use according to U.S. laws.

What Ingredients Give Copper Lipstick Its Shine?

Brands use special ingredients to create that beautiful copper glow:

  • Metallic pigments like mica and pearl powder
  • Red and bronze oxides that give warm colors
  • Oils or butters that soften and moisturize lips

These ingredients work together to make your lips shine and feel soft.

How to Apply Copper Lipstick

  1. Start with clean, smooth lips.

How to Take Care of Your Lips

To keep your lips healthy while wearing copper lipstick:

  • Drink plenty of water to stay hydrated
  • Gently exfoliate your lips once a week to remove dry skin
  • Use lip balm daily to keep your lips soft and smooth

How to Remove Copper Lipstick

Removing copper lipstick is easy:

  • Use lipstick remover or micellar water on a cotton pad
  • Or gently wipe with baby oil or coconut oil before rinsing
  • After removal, apply lip balm to protect your lips

Glossary

Pigments:
The color components used in lipstick that give it its distinctive shade. These are finely ground particles that provide the rich color you see when you apply lipstick.

Metallic Finish:
A shiny, reflective effect on lipstick that resembles the look of metal. This finish gives lips a shimmering, lustrous appearance, often with a slight sparkle or shine.

Emollients:
Ingredients in lipsticks and other cosmetics that help soften, soothe, and protect the skin. They keep your lips hydrated by locking in moisture and preventing dryness or cracking.

ppm (Parts Per Million):
A measurement unit used to describe very small concentrations of a substance within another. For example, if a lipstick contains a pigment at 50 ppm, it means there are 50 parts of that pigment per one million parts of the product.
